We are seeking talented and experienced NMC registered nurses who are keen to progress their career and feel that they have the potential management and leadership capability demanded by the role of Deputy Ward Manager.

The successful applicants will assist with the clinical development of the ward through managing staff and monitoring clinical standards and practice. They will work closely with the Ward Manager to achieve ward targets and deliver high quality patient care.

As Deputy Ward Manager, your role will be to co-ordinate the quality and management of nursing care, patient care and the clinical environment. Participate fully with the multidisciplinary team and undertake direct patient care. Manage and direct the delivery of clinical services within a ward or unit, ensuring it complies with statutory regulations, current legislation and meets quality standards.

To be successful as Deputy Ward Manager:
- A relevant healthcare qualification, preferably a qualified mental health nurse.
- At Least 2 years post qualifying experience.

About the Hospital

Priory Hospital Dorking is an 18 acute male admission hospital with a 3 bed rehabilitation and recovery service for women with complex mental health needs.

Our comprehensive multi-disciplinary team pride our selves on our ability to work both with enduring mental illness but also those who struggle with regulating emotions, acts of impulsivity and managing relationships.

The hospital is set in picturesque grounds overlooking the Surrey Hills and has extensive facilities including onsite Gym, Purpose Built OT Kitchen aswell as Occupational Facililties. You will also have free access to the onsite gym facilities.
